The FanIQ Nascar Sprint Cup Commissioner Challenge: Allstate 400 at the Brickyard

Two weeks after Kyle Busch muscled his way past Jimmie Johnson in the closing laps to win the LifeLock.com 400, the Nascar Sprint Cup Series heads to Indianapolis for the Allstate 400 at the Brickyard.  Last year at this race, Reed Sorenson sat on the pole in his Chip Ganassi Dodge but it was Tony Stewart who took home the win in his home state, ahead of Juan Pablo Montoya, Jeff Gordon, Kyle Busch and Reed Sorenson.  Can Stewart make it back to back and register his first win of the 2008 season?  Will Stewart's teammate, Kyle Busch, continue to drive away from the field and take home his 8th win of the year?  Will this be the race that the Hendrick crew gets one of there Chevy's back in victory lane?  After an impressive team performance in Joliet, will the Roush Fenway Ford's pick a win on the most famous track in the world?  Will this be the race that the RCR Chevy's get back into the win column?  Can the Dodge's shock the world and take home the top spot?  How will the rookies fare in there first race at Indy?  Which qualify or go home drivers will have the best finish?  Answer these questions and the ones below for the Allstate 400 at the Brickyard?
